Into content:
Twelve variants in all; two for Rictus; Skryre, Pestilens, and Moulder; three for Eshin + one unaffiliated.
No scavenger or expressly "non-skaven" looks. I.e, no variants with Lizardmen armour.
Compatible with the Variant Selector Mod (Highly recommended.)
A unique weapon and shield is given to each variant, so Skryres get tech-blades.
New Unit-cards and Port-holes for all variants.
No replaced variants, so the total is 13 *wink wink.* The price of progress.
No compatibility issues afaik; nor should there be any.
Should work with other Variant mods and mods that add mounts.
